public class LdapHelper
extends java.lang.Object
| Modifier and Type | Method and Description |
|---|---|
static void |
checkLDAPGroupFilter(java.lang.String groupFilter) |
static void |
checkLDAPParameters(LdapParameters ldapParameters) |
static void |
checkLDAPUserFilter(java.lang.String userFilter) |
static java.lang.String |
checkMandatoryAttribute(IImportLogger importLogger,
org.apache.directory.api.ldap.model.entry.Entry entry,
java.lang.String attribute) |
static LdapConProxy |
connectLdap(Parameters ldapParameters) |
static java.util.Optional<UserManager> |
getLdapUser(LdapParameters ldapParameters,
ItemValue<Domain> domain,
java.lang.String userLogin,
ItemValue<User> bmUser,
MailFilter mailFilter) |
public static void checkLDAPParameters(LdapParameters ldapParameters) throws ServerFault
ServerFaultpublic static java.util.Optional<UserManager> getLdapUser(LdapParameters ldapParameters, ItemValue<Domain> domain, java.lang.String userLogin, ItemValue<User> bmUser, MailFilter mailFilter)
public static void checkLDAPUserFilter(java.lang.String userFilter)
throws ServerFault
ServerFaultpublic static void checkLDAPGroupFilter(java.lang.String groupFilter)
throws ServerFault
ServerFaultpublic static LdapConProxy connectLdap(Parameters ldapParameters) throws ServerFault
ServerFaultpublic static java.lang.String checkMandatoryAttribute(IImportLogger importLogger, org.apache.directory.api.ldap.model.entry.Entry entry, java.lang.String attribute)
Copyright © 2022. All Rights Reserved.